To apply for the BA Psychology (Hons) programme at Banaras Hindu University (BHU), you must go through the Common University Entrance Test (CUET) for Undergraduate courses. This test is mandatory for all applicants, and you must meet the eligibility criteria, which include passing your 12th exam with the required percentage and relevant subjects.
The admission process follows these general steps:
- Apply for CUET UG: You need to register online for the CUET UG exam via the official website.

Jindal School of Psychology and Counselling is India's first transdisciplinary Psychology school. The flagship programmes offered at Jindal School of Psychology and Counselling are BA and BSc (Hons). The college offers these programmes to students at the UG level.
Jindal School of Psychology and Counselling admissions to UG programmes are conducted on the basis of entrance exam scores. Some of the popular entrance exams accepted by college are JSAT, SAT, ACT, LNAT-UK, etc. To get admitted to the college, candidates must meet the eligibility criteria set by the college.
